The more I check in, the more inclined I am to think that an idea my sister
and I discussed in the past is worth resurrecting:  that of starting a
school for gifted children. It is daunting one, but the more I ponder it,
the more it seems a viable alternative to grappling with the system already
in place, and the politics that go with it.

 

My experience of the gifted education available locally is that much is
costly, or just non-existent. My son's school mailed his report card home.
It's riddled with "F"s... and while I'll assume some responsibility, He and
the school can shoulder the rest. On a larger scale, society should as well.
It seems most people appreciate the inventions and innovations gifted minds
bring to being, but like art, while it's appreciated, precious few actually
want to help fund it; this is an unfortunate state of affairs.
